Output 66628108b7abe608dc387ba02a2eec4c34dcd20f8ee51090d912157ccf90d961:1

value
10000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ffb8d26449c81ae6b53d91e451dad9e0d50086e8 OP_EQUALVERIFY OP_CHECKSIG
address
1QK8iZggy4aP59mwwa4AsMxziUXnkbGuA9
transaction
66628108b7abe608dc387ba02a2eec4c34dcd20f8ee51090d912157ccf90d961